Oleksandr Kozachuk 9b1cc0cace feat(core): INCLUDE, error overhaul, sf64 lane, WORDS ALL, .RS
WS-012 -- INCLUDE/INCLUDED:
- Injected source loader (core stays IO-free: CLI installs a
  filesystem reader, web leaves it unset -> defined error). Recursive
  include_file feeds files line-by-line through evaluate, so compile
  state and SEE capture span lines for free. Cycle detection, depth
  cap 16, paths relative to the including file, SOURCE-ID per nesting
  level, parent input restored on success/error/BYE.
- CLI file mode now runs through the include machinery: `wafer x.fth`
  gets file:line error context and a base dir for nested INCLUDEs.
- Unlocks the REMEMBER+INCLUDE reload loop.

WS-008 -- error reporting remainder:
- Errors inside included files carry `file.fth:12:` context
  (anyhow context chain; CLI prints {e:#}).
- describe_uncaught now returns typed WaferError::UncaughtThrow
  { code, message } -- display text unchanged, THROW code reachable
  via downcast for CLI/web consumers.
- compile_word emits a WASM name section; wasmtime trap backtraces
  name the faulting word and runtime_native prefixes "in <WORD>:".
  Batch/consolidated modules stay unnamed (no name plumbing there;
  boot primitives rarely trap).

WS-003 -- SwiftForth correctness lane:
- compare_all_programs_sf64 runs the program corpus with sf64 as
  oracle; whitespace-token comparison (sf64 prints numbers
  space-prefixed and echoes piped lines). 34/35 parity; dot-quote
  skipped (interpret-mode ." is a SwiftForth no-op). #[ignore]d like
  the gforth lane; `just compare-correctness` runs both.

WS-011 leftovers:
- WORDS ALL: grouped full view -- one section per wordlist (search
  order first), then internal words, each with counts. Backed by
  Dictionary::visible_entries (name, wid, internal); visible_words
  now derives from it.
- .RS / RDEPTH: return-stack introspection in boot.fth over a new
  RP@ primitive (IrOp::RpFetch); BEGIN/WHILE walk so the walk never
  touches the stack it prints. SPACES clamped per 6.1.2230.

549 unit + 11 compliance + 9(+2) comparison + 5 crypto + 1 bench
green; fmt/clippy clean; --no-default-features and wasm32 web checks
pass.

Makefile

default:
just --list
# Build everything
build:
cargo build --workspace
# Run all tests
test:
cargo test --workspace
# Run Forth 2012 compliance tests
compliance:
cargo test --test compliance -- --nocapture
# Run clippy lints
clippy:
cargo clippy --workspace -- -D warnings
# Check formatting (Rust + Markdown)
fmt:
cargo fmt --all --check
dprint check
# Format code (Rust + Markdown)
fmt-fix:
cargo fmt --all
dprint fmt
# Run the REPL
repl:
cargo run -p wafer
# Run a Forth file
run file:
cargo run -p wafer -- {{file}}
# Run benchmarks
bench:
cargo bench --workspace
# Run optimization benchmark report
bench-opts:
cargo test -p wafer-core --test benchmark_report -- --nocapture --ignored
# Cross-engine performance report: WAFER vs gforth vs SwiftForth (sf64)
bench-compare:
CARGO_PROFILE_RELEASE_STRIP=none cargo test -p wafer-core --release --test comparison -- --nocapture --ignored performance_report
# Cross-engine correctness lanes: program corpus vs gforth + sf64 oracles
compare-correctness:
cargo test -p wafer-core --test comparison -- --nocapture --ignored compare_all_programs
# Check dependency licenses and advisories
deny:
cargo deny check
# Detect unused dependencies
machete:
cargo machete --skip-target-dir
# Full CI check (what CI runs)
ci: fmt clippy deny test
# Check compilation without running
check:
cargo check --workspace
# Install bat syntax highlighting for WAFER / Forth
install-syntax:
mkdir -p ~/.config/bat/syntaxes
cp tools/editor-support/bat/WAFER.sublime-syntax ~/.config/bat/syntaxes/
bat cache --build
